Mass casualty incidents. Natural disasters. Emergencies such as these can quickly overwhelm even the most advanced, well-equipped, and fully staffed hospital. This is especially true if a facility’s Emergency Operations Plan, or EOP, is lacking information, out of date, or for some reason, inaccessible. Communication (EM.02.02.01) Resources and assets (EM.02.02.03) Safety and security (EM.02.02.05) Staff responsibilities (EM.02.02.07) WebThe four phases of emergency management are mitigation, preparedness, response, and recovery. They occur over time; mitigation and preparedness generally occur before an emergency, and response and recovery occur during and after an emergency.
